Advertisement
Guest User

CCCam working config

a guest
Oct 20th, 2010
451
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Perl 5.81 KB | None | 0 0
  1. F: gizmo gizmo 0 1 1
  2. F: gizmo2 gizmo2 0 1 1
  3. F: gizmo3 gizmo3 0 1 1
  4. F: gizmo4 gizmo4 0 1 1
  5. F: gizmo5 gizmo5 0 1 1
  6. F: gizmo1 gizmo1 0 1 1
  7. F: gizmo6 gizmo6 0 1 1
  8. F: gizmo7 gizmo7 0 1 1
  9. F: gizmo8 gizmo8 0 1 1
  10. F: gizmo9 gizmo9 0 1 1
  11. F: gizmo10 gizmo10 0 1 1
  12. SERVER LISTEN PORT : 12000
  13.  
  14. #CAID PRIO FILE: /etc/cccam/cccam.prio
  15.  
  16. SERIAL READER : /dev/ttyS0
  17. #SMARTCARD SID ASSIGN : /dev/ttyS0 2 { 0x709, 0x70A }
  18. #SMARTCARD WRITE DELAY : /dev/ttyS0 3000
  19.  
  20. # Serial reader smartcard write delay.
  21. # Setting to finetune smartcard write speed, optimal setting depends on speed of system, and
  22. # speed of card. Default value is calculated, but can overrule by setting.
  23. # Use number of microseconds delay between bytes, 0 = no delay, -1 = calculated default
  24. # Note: huge difference between values 0 and 1, because of schedular overhead
  25. #
  26. #SMARTCARD WRITE DELAY : /dev/ttyS0 30
  27. #
  28. # example, 10ms write delay on smartcard in reader attached to /dev/ttyUSB0
  29. #
  30.  
  31. DEBUG : yes
  32.  
  33.  
  34. # disable all local EMM readers
  35. # saves lots of CPU, but you won't get any updates anymore
  36. # (unless you get updates from your clients)
  37. #
  38. # default: no
  39. #
  40. DISABLE EMM : no
  41.  
  42. # with this setting you can
  43. # allow a client on two hops away
  44. # to send the updates to the cardserver
  45. #
  46. # default : no
  47. #
  48. EXTRA EMM LEVEL : yes
  49.  
  50. # with this setting you can
  51. # configure how many emm listeners are started.
  52. # for example use 2 when recording
  53. # and viewing different systems and both need constant updates
  54. #
  55. # default : 1
  56. #
  57. EMM THREADS : 1
  58.  
  59. # overrule the nds boxkey (4 byte hex)
  60. #
  61. # BOXKEY: <device> <byte1> <byte2> <byte3> <byte4>
  62. #
  63. #example
  64. #
  65. #BOXKEY: /dev/sci0 00 11 22 33
  66.  
  67. # set card pin
  68. # * please be very careful with this option as you could lock your card *
  69. #
  70. # PIN: <device> <pin>
  71. #
  72. #example
  73. #
  74. #PIN: /dev/sci0 1234
  75.  
  76. # overrule the irdeto camkey (8 byte hex), default 11 22 33 44 55 66 77 88
  77. #
  78. # CAMKEY: <device> <byte1> <byte2> <byte3> <byte4> <byte5> <byte6> <byte7> <byte8>
  79. #
  80. #example
  81. #
  82. #CAMKEY: /dev/sci0 11 22 33 44 55 66 77 88
  83.  
  84. # overrule the irdeto camdata (64 byte hex)
  85. # trailing zero bytes can be omitted
  86. # default for unknown ASC's is 11 22 33 44 55 66 77 88 00 00 .. 00, known ASC's have other defaults
  87. #
  88. # CAMDATA: <device> <byte1> <byte2> <byte3> <byte4> <byte5> <byte6> ... <byte64>
  89. #
  90. #example, when only the first 15 camdata bytes are nonzero
  91. #
  92. #CAMDATA: /dev/sci0 11 22 33 44 55 66 77 88 99 aa bb cc dd ee ff
  93.  
  94. # custom add id's for BEEF patched cards
  95. #
  96. # BEEF ID: <ident1> <ident2> <ident3> <ident4> <ident5> <ident6> <ident7> <ident8> <device>
  97. #
  98. #example
  99. #
  100. #BEEF ID: 4101 0 0 0 0 0 0 0 /dev/sci0
  101.  
  102. # what Softcam.Key should CCcam try to read
  103. # defaults to /var/keys/SoftCam.Key
  104. #
  105. #SOFTKEY FILE : /var/keys/SoftCam.Key
  106.  
  107.  
  108. # what AutoRoll.Key should CCcam try to read
  109. # defaults to /var/keys/AutoRoll.Key
  110. #
  111. #AUTOROLL FILE : /var/keys/AutoRoll.Key
  112.  
  113.  
  114. # what constant.cw should CCcam try to read
  115. # defaults to /var/keys/constant.cw
  116. # file content can be like
  117. #
  118. # ca4:id6:sid4:pmtpid4:ecmpid4:key16(01 02 03...)
  119. #
  120. #STATIC CW FILE : /var/keys/constant.cw
  121.  
  122.  
  123. LOG WARNINGS : /tmp/warnings.txt
  124.  
  125. # global setting for stealthy login to newcamd/newcs server, N line can overrule
  126. # stealth modes: 0 = disabled, 1 = mgcamd new, 2 = mgcamd old, 3 = evocamd, 4 = generic
  127. # default: 0
  128. #
  129. #NEWCAMD STEALTH : 0
  130.  
  131. # load balancing between identical cards, list device names of card readers containing identical cards,
  132. # optionally followed by a list of service id's which are to be excluded from loadbalancing
  133. #
  134. # LOADBALANCE : <device1> <device2> .. <devicen> { <exceptsid1>, <exceptsid2> .. , <exceptsidn> }
  135. #
  136. # multiple loadbalance groups can be configured, by adding multiple lines
  137. # warning: restart is required, when loadbalance group config changes
  138. #
  139. #example 1: load balance requests for three identical cards
  140. #
  141. # LOADBALANCE : /dev/ttyS0 /dev/ttyS1 /dev/ttyS2
  142. #
  143. #example 2: load balance requests for two almost identical cards, sid 0df3 and 0de1 are only available
  144. #on one of the cards, so requests for these sids shouldn't be loadbalanced
  145. #
  146. # LOADBALANCE : /dev/ttyS5 /dev/ttyS6 { 0df3,0de1 }
  147.  
  148. # in version 1.2.1 and lower there was a problem which could lead to disconnecting clients
  149. # in version 1.4.0 network load was significantly reduced
  150. # in version 1.7.0 dangerous password bug was fixed
  151. # in order to take advantage of these fixes, all clients should upgrade
  152. # with this setting you can force that clients at least use a certain version otherwise they are denied when logging in
  153. #
  154. # default : accept all versions
  155. #
  156. #example 1: avoid disconnecting clients problem
  157. #
  158. #MINIMUM CLIENT VERSION : 1.3.0
  159. #
  160. #example 2: achieve network load decrease
  161. #
  162. #MINIMUM CLIENT VERSION : 1.4.0
  163. #
  164. #example 3: don't allow potentially wrong passwords (pre 1.7.0 has password bug)
  165. #
  166. #MINIMUM CLIENT VERSION : 1.7.0
  167.  
  168.  
  169. # Irdeto smartcards: option to disable smart chid checking for irdeto smartcards.
  170. # Default, only chids advertised by card are accepted.
  171. # This avoids a lot of unwanted card traffic
  172. #
  173. # But if smartcard has hidden/unknown chids, all chids should be tried.
  174. # In that case specify 'TRY ALL CHIDS' option for cardreader.
  175. # Use with care, enabling option causes more card traffic.
  176. # Only use setting when some channels don't work without it.
  177. # note: if even this setting don't help decode all channels, try using
  178. # commandline arg -l, to disable all self-learning features (warning: slower)
  179. #
  180. #TRY ALL CHIDS : /dev/ttyS0
  181. #
  182. #example: card in /dev/ttyUSB0 gets ecm for all possible chids, not
  183. #just the chids it officially supports
  184. #
  185. #TRY ALL CHIDS : /dev/ttyUSB0
  186.  
  187. # Option to override autodetected dvb api version. Restart needed.
  188. #
  189. #DVB API: <value>
  190. #
  191. # <value> -1 = no dvb, 1 = dvb api 1, 3 = dvb api 3
  192. #
  193. # WARNING: only use when autodetect fails!
  194. #
  195. #example, disable nonworking dvb hardware:
  196. DVB API: -1
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ement